Basically, this law mentions that the will has to be authorized by the testator & #x 2013; or the individual making the will & #x 2013; and supervised by 2 witnesses that sign the will with the testator existing. If the handwritten will isn't correctly witnessed or signed, then it will not be viewed as valid in the eyes of the regulation.
In many cases, Antoinette the estate will certainly after that be managed according to the regulations of intestate sequence. In many cases, this will indicate that the estate is divided between the making it through partner and any making it through youngsters. In cases where the new will does not entirely get rid of the estate, indicating that the will overlooks certain parts of the estate, then the will certainly is presumed to be adding to the terms of the previous will. Any time a new will certainly omits part of an estate, after that the most current will certainly that talks about that part of the estate is presumed to be legitimate, [empty] partially, except in instances where the new will definitively proclaims all previous wills void.

The validity of holographic wills is regulated by each district or region.
Thus, handwriting a will might appear an easy (and inexpensive) technique for arranging to throw away one's ownerships at fatality. The fundamental demands of a legitimate Pennsylvania will do not include witnesses. Normally, as long as you fulfill the writing and finalizing requirements, witnesses are not needed when you sign your will. A holographic will is the simplest method to designate where your residential or commercial property needs to go after you die.
